Encounter

  I was born on black sand

Of a people whose grief know no bounds

Groomed with stringent measures

And made to rely on hope so ethereal


Life was rigid like the god of oghene

I upheld rules as numerous as sand 

All in a bid to avoid the wrath of the gods

With permanent smite hidden in my heart


They were swift at the table of sacrifice

Eager to slit the throat of a Young virgin

To appease a god whose desire

Is to keep taking till our souls are given


I looked deep into the great portrait

Moping around in search of love

Perhaps an atom of humanity

All I saw was ruthlessness


I raised my hands to the skies in frustration

Seeking for a god whose burden was lighter

Tears flowed like blood from ogbete shrine

I tarried in Oblivion till dusk


Out of thunder, a voice persists

From the skies came consolation

Piercing deep into my heart

Leaving a permanent scar that I called encounter


"I have loved you with a love that is divine

Even before you knew love

I do not need you, Somehow I want you

I am your Creator"
